🔍 Patent Alert
Two Lightsynq patents show how important this acquisition was for IonQ. They prove IonQ now has key intellectual property that makes large-scale quantum networking possible, not just something to talk about in theory.
The first patent, US Patent 12,260,113, covers a compact quantum memory module that can store entanglement and work as part of a repeater node. In simple terms, this means entanglement can be packaged up and deployed wherever it's needed, instead of being stuck in a single location. That's what makes distributed workloads and coordinated operations across different networks feasible. Basically, it's what you need if you actually want to build a working quantum internet. Strategically this puts IonQ in a position to deliver entanglement-as-a-service to governments and enterprises and to build a secure transport layer across regions.
The second patent, US Patent 12,265,254, describes a way to precisely connect photonic waveguides to quantum memory or processors without a lot of manual tweaking. This solves a big manufacturing problem that has held back the industry for years. By improving yield and reducing costs, this approach makes it realistic for IonQ to roll out thousands of nodes, not just a few prototypes. From a strategy perspective, this shows IonQ is ready to move past lab demonstrations and start scaling quantum networking as real infrastructure.
Taken together, these patents show that Lightsynq wasn't just an early-stage research project. IonQ now has protected methods that let it deploy entanglement memory modules wherever needed, manufacture photonic connections at volume, and combine compute, memory, and transport into one integrated platform.
No other quantum company has this same combination in a single stack: trusted compute through IonQ OS, trusted memory with portable modules, and trusted transport using scalable photonics.
This gives IonQ the ability to build global entanglement networks, sync workloads for partners and governments, and turn quantum networking into a steady revenue stream. It also reinforces IonQ's core story that trusted runtime and trusted transport are converging into one product.
These patents move IonQ beyond being just a hardware maker. They lay the foundation for an integrated quantum networking business that can actually scale. This is protected technology that makes it possible to deploy entanglement nodes at scale, manufacture reliable photonic connections, and build a defensible position in secure quantum networking.
In plain terms, this is how IonQ's vision becomes something real in the market.
